The Tromsø: Small-Group Northern Lights Chase by Van with Photos offers a highly personalized way to witness the Aurora Borealis. This 7-hour tour departs from Kaigata 4 in Tromsø and is limited to just 8 guests, ensuring an intimate, relaxed atmosphere. How long is the tour?
The tour lasts about 7 hours, starting in the evening and including scenic driving, stops, and time spent searching for the Aurora.
Where does the tour start?
It begins at Kaigata 4 in Tromsø, in front of the Magic Ice Bar.
What is included in the tour?
The tour includes transport in a warm van, thermal suits, hot drinks and Norwegian food, and professional photography guidance.
Is there a guarantee to see the Northern Lights?
Yes, the tour features a Northern Lights guarantee, striving to maximize the chances of Aurora sightings, depending on weather conditions.
What should I bring?
Guests should wear warm clothing and warm shoes suitable for Arctic conditions.
How many people are in the group?
The tour is limited to a maximum of 8 guests for a more personal experience.
Can I participate if I’m not a photographer?
Absolutely. The photo tips are helpful even for beginners, and the overall experience is designed to be enjoyable regardless of photography experience.
What happens if the weather is bad?
Guides will adapt the route based on weather forecasts and Aurora activity, aiming to find clear skies for the best possible viewing.
Is food included?
Yes, hot drinks and traditional Norwegian food are part of the experience to keep everyone warm and comfortable.
